NY J89866 November 13, 2003 CLA-2-87:RR:NC:MM:101 J89866 CATEGORY: Classification TARIFF NO.: 8708.99.6790 Mr. J. O. Alvarez Jr. J. O. Alvarez, Incorporated P.O. Box 1434 Laredo, Texas 78042-1434 RE: The tariff classification of an automotive Integrated Transfer Case from Mexico Dear: Mr. Alvarez In your letter dated October 20, 2003 you requested a tariff classification ruling. You submitted a detailed description of the assembly of the Integrated Transfer Case (ITC), a detailed parts list with part number, units, origin, supply name and address, and a Power-Point type printed presentation of the technical description. You state that the ITC is used to split the torque of the engine to provide both the rear and front axle with toque. The torque to the front axle output shaft is transferred via chain. The applicable subheading for the automotive Integrated Transfer Case will be 8708.99.6790,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TS), which provides for Parts and accessories of the motor vehicles of headings 8701 to 8705: Other parts and accessories: Other: Other: Other: Other parts for power trains…Other. The rate of duty will be 2.5% ad valorem. This ruling is being issued under the provisions of Part 177 of the Customs Regulations (19 C.F.R. 177). A copy of the ruling or the control number indicated above should be provided with the entry documents filed at the time this merchandise is imported.
